Turkey Burger with Spicy Cranberry Sauce
INGREDIENTS
  • 1 lb. turkey breast fillets
  • 2 tbl. chives, chopped finely
  • 1 egg, beaten lightly
  • 1 clove garlic, crushed
  • salt & pepper to taste
  • 1-2 tbs. breadcrumbs
  • oil for frying
  • 1 sourdough bread loaf
  • red leaf lettuce for serving
  • 8 slices mozzarella cheese
DIRECTIONS
  1. Trim turkey of excess fat and sinew; chop coarsely.
  2. Place in food processor for 20-30 seconds or until finely chopped.
  3. Combine in large bowl with chives, egg, garlic, salt, pepper and bread crumbs.
  4. Mix with hands, divide into 4 parts and shape into patties.
  5. Heat oil in large heavy-based frying pan and cook patties over medium heat for 3-4 minutes each side or until golden and cooked through. Drain on paper towels and keep warm.
  6. Cut bread loaf into 8 slices and lightly toast with butter.
  7. Build onto the toasted sourdough - lettuce leaves, a turkey patty, cheese, spiced cranberry sauce and top with another piece of toast
